Detecting minerals on a huge hyperspectral dataset (> To) is a difficult task that we proposed to address using linear unmixing techniques. We test different algorithms with positivity constrains on a typical Martian hyperspectral image of the Syrtis Major volcanic complex. The usefulness of additional constraints, such as sparsity and sum-to-one constrains are discussed. We compare the results with a supervised detection technique based on band ratio.
